WebPennsylvania corporate bylaws are the rules that govern your corporation’s operations and create an organizational structure for your company. Bylaws outline policies for appointing directors and officers, holding shareholder and board meetings, and handling conflicts of interest, among other issues. WebCorporate bylaws are not submitted to the state. Although it is not a legal requirement, it is highly recommended that businesses create bylaws for their California corporation. Bylaws allow a business to maintain consistency in the way it operates, and communicate organizational rules to help avoid conflicts and disputes.
